Shen Daohong (China, b. 1947), Playing the Chess Ink and colour on paper, framed Signed Daohong, with six seals of the artist, and one seal of Wan Fung Art Gallery where the work was sold Dated summer of 1990 182 cm x 96.5 cm. Provenance: Private collection NSW, purchased in Wan Fun Art Gallery in HK in 1993, accompanied with a certificate issued by the gallery (1990)
